Just wanted to warn others to stay away from all natural Scotts Topsoil found at Walmart or any hardware store. The bag claims there is no sticks or other debris when in fact there was a lot.
I bought it trying to save a little bit of cash instead of replacing coconut fiber so much. It comes in the big bags for $2. My pixie got messed up from it for about a month and half, barely eating, lethargic, and not going in water. As soon as I put him back on coconut fiber he has been active, back in the water, and eating dubia like a beast.
